Council Tax

Volume 479: debated on Monday 21 July 2008

To ask the Secretary of State for Communities and Local Government what plans are under consideration by her Department for the reform of council tax. (220033)

The Government support the conclusions of Sir Michael Lyons' independent inquiry, that council tax as a property based tax is broadly sound and should be retained. However we keep the detail of council tax administration continually under review. We are currently considering the feasibility of enabling local authorities to transfer the enforcement of council tax debts from magistrates courts to county courts in appropriate cases.
